Browse Source

Updated publish_docs.sh script. #10

Sebastian Haas 8 years ago
parent
commit
a2a4763a78
1 changed files with 7 additions and 1 deletions
  1. 7 1
      bin/publish_docs.sh

+ 7 - 1
bin/publish_docs.sh

@@ -1,9 +1,15 @@
 #!/bin/bash
 
+grunt docs
 git clone git@github.com:opensheetmusicdisplay/opensheetmusicdisplay.github.io.git
-rsync -a ./build/docs ./opensheetmusicdisplay.github.io.git
+cd opensheetmusicdisplay.github.io
+git status
+rsync -a ../build/docs/* ./
 git status
 git add *
 git commit -m "Pushed auto-generated class documentation for $TRAVIS_TAG"
 git tag -a $TRAVIS_TAG -m "Class documentation for $TRAVIS_TAG"
 git push origin master --follow-tags
+echo "Deployed class documentation for $TRAVIS_TAG successfully."
+cd ..
+rm -rf opensheetmusicdisplay.github.io